Computers in this contemporary epoch can quickly and accurately translate languages. Hence, learning a foreign language is a sheer wastage of time. This essay completely disagrees with this statement because firstly, learning such skills helps in the holistic development of individuals, and secondly, it uplifts the chances of employment. To begin with, learning a foreign language makes a significant contribution to the comprehensive development of people. As there is no denying this conviction that learning a foreign language enhances their knowledge and personality. Thus by acquiring proficiency in a foreign language, they have immense information and stay up to date. For instance, a recent study conducted by Harvard University revealed that the people who know foreign languages have better knowledge than others. Moreover, learning a foreign language is a prudent approach because it bestows you with enhanced work options. It is intuitively true that those people who can communicate in more than one language are suitable for companies and organizations. Their enhanced skill set empowers them to get sufficient work opportunities not only locally but also globally. Consequently, they find it easy to carve out a niche for themselves and lead their lives towards an impressive growth trajectory even in fierce competition. Japan is the prime example where people learn more than one foreign language, and the unemployment rate is low there. To conclude, learning a foreign language is a worthwhile proposition because it plays a crucial role in the overall development of individuals and creates high chances of success in finding jobs.
